CHIPS R&D OFFICE SETA SUPPORT SERVICES IN 1) NOTICE OF FUNDING OPPORTUNITY (NOFO) PROGRAM MANAGEMENT SUPPORT, 2) NOFO TECHNICAL SUPPORT, 3) BUSINESS OPERATIONS AND PROGRAM ARCHITECTURE SUPPORT, AND 4) POLICY AND ANALYTICAL SUPPORT. is a federal award for Department of Commerce (DOC) held by BOOZ ALLEN HAMILTON INC.. Estimated value $13M ($13M obligated). Current period of performance ends Mar 8, 2026. Last award drew 19 bidders. Place of performance: MCLEAN VA.

Recompete timingPublic
Past PoP end (141 days ago)

Current PoP ended Mar 8, 2026 (141 days ago). The usual 12–18 month agency planning window is closed — recompete action looks late / overdue relative to a normal cycle. Watch for bridge orders, follow-ons, or a new solicitation.
